Starved Rock State Park, Utica

Start your adventure at Starved Rock State Park in Utica. It's not just a camping destination; it's an exploration of Illinois' wild heart. With 129 campsites, including options with electric hookups, your Mini-T Campervan will feel right at home. The real allure? The park's 18 canyons carved by glacial meltwater, with waterfalls that are especially stunning in the spring or after heavy rains. Hike the trails, spot local wildlife, and immerse yourself in the breathtaking scenery.

Kankakee River State Park, Bourbonnais

Kankakee River State Park is your next stop. Spanning both sides of the Kankakee River, this park offers 140 campsites with electric hookups, ensuring your Mini-T Campervan is comfortably accommodated. It's a paradise for anglers, hikers, and anyone looking to relax by the riverside. The park's trails offer serene walks through forests and along riverbanks, ideal for those peaceful mornings or tranquil sunsets.

Turkey Run State Park, Indiana (Near Illinois)

Though technically in Indiana, Turkey Run State Park is a must-visit easily accessible from Illinois. It's a place where nature's artwork is on full display through its sandstone ravines and gorges. Offering a mix of primitive campsites and cabins, it provides various options for every type of camper. The park's trails challenge and reward with their beauty, making it a perfect spot for those looking to add a bit of adventure to their trip.

Matthiessen State Park, Oglesby

Matthiessen State Park is a hidden gem with its fascinating rock formations and waterfalls. With 34 campsites equipped with electric hookups, it's ideal for Mini-T Campervan travelers looking for a mix of adventure and comfort. The park offers a unique landscape for photography, hiking, and simply enjoying the tranquility of nature.

Giant City State Park, Makanda

Explore the "Giant City Streets" formed by massive sandstone bluffs at Giant City State Park. Your Mini-T Campervan will find a cozy spot among the park's various camping options, from primitive sites to RV sites with electric hookups. The park's trails offer breathtaking views and encounters with diverse plant and animal life, perfect for nature enthusiasts.

Pere Marquette State Park, Grafton

Pere Marquette State Park sits atop the bluffs overlooking the Illinois River, offering stunning vistas and a rich history. With camping options that include electric hookups, your Mini-T Campervan will be perfectly situated to explore. The park's trails and scenic drives provide a peaceful retreat into nature, with opportunities for bird watching, especially during the fall hawk migration.

Clinton Lake State Recreation Area, DeWitt County

For water enthusiasts, Clinton Lake State Recreation Area is an ideal spot. With over 200 campsites with electric hookups, it caters well to Mini-T Campervan travelers. The lake itself offers excellent fishing, boating, and water sports, while the surrounding trails invite you to explore the area's natural beauty on foot or by bike.

Photo

Rock Cut State Park, Loves Park

Rock Cut State Park is a haven for outdoor activities, with 270 campsites, including electric hookups for your Mini-T Campervan. Whether you're into fishing, hiking, or simply enjoying a day at the beach, this park has something for everyone. The park's two lakes are perfect for a day of kayaking or paddleboarding, making it a versatile destination for all types of travelers.
